Vanuatu Speaker loses appeal over failed attempt to remove Prime Minister Natapei

5:43 pm on 18 December 2009

Vanuatu's Court of Appeal has thrown out an appeal by the Parliamentary Speaker, Maxime Carlot Korman, over his attempt to declare the Prime Minister's seat vacant.

Earlier this month Chief Justice Vincent Lunabek declared Mr Carlot Korman's decision that Prime Minister Edward Natapei had lost his seat for failing to notifying Parliament of his absence from the country during November, was unconstitutional and has no legal effect.

Mr Carlot Korman appealed but Justice Oliver Saksak today issue an oral decision dismissing the application.
